WebA section 21 notice is the legal form used to obtain possession of a buy-to-let property. Section 21 refers to section 21 of the Housing Act 1988 that brought this notice into being. It is a legal template that enables a landlord to bring a tenancy to an end providing certain criteria are met. WebA landlord can use a section 21 (1) (b) notice for fixed term and statutory periodic tenancies. This notice must give at least two months' notice. [ 8] A statutory periodic tenancy arises automatically when a fixed term assured shorthold tenancy ends other than by a court order or a surrender.
